About The Role
Join National Grid’s CNI Infrastructure Support Team as a CNI Automation Lead Engineer. In this role, you’ll be responsible for designing, implementing, and governing automated solutions across IT infrastructure operations to drive efficiency, scalability, and reliability. You’ll lead the automation strategy for operational processes, reducing manual effort, minimizing human error, and accelerating service delivery across data centre, network, and platform environments. You’ll take ownership of project lifecycles from concept to production, developing automation strategies that enhance quality and productivity while supporting the resilience of our critical systems. If you’re able to innovate and thrive in a fast‑paced environment, this is your chance to make a real impact.
What You’ll Do
- Lead Automation Strategy – Define and own the infrastructure automation roadmap, championing an automation‑first mindset across operations.
- Design & Deliver Solutions – Build and maintain scalable automation frameworks for provisioning, configuration, patching, and decommissioning.
- Drive Operational Excellence – Automate high‑volume, error‑prone tasks to boost efficiency and reliability, integrating monitoring tools for proactive issue detection.
- Set Standards & Governance – Establish best practices for tooling, security, coding standards, and CI/CD, ensuring compliance with regulatory and organisational requirements.
- Collaborate & Influence – Work closely with engineering, operations, and service teams to embed automation into everyday processes.
- Optimize & Innovate – Continuously identify opportunities to improve processes, measure impact, and enhance resilience through automated recovery strategies.
About You
- Strong knowledge of enterprise IT infrastructure (compute, storage, backup, OS: Windows/Linux/Unix, middleware) and virtualization technologies.
- Expertise in Infrastructure as Code (IaC) principles, lifecycle management, and automation frameworks.
- Hands‑on experience with scripting and automation languages, run‑book automation, and orchestration tools.
- Solid understanding of DevOps, Site Reliability Engineering (SRE), and CI/CD pipelines for infrastructure automation.
- Knowledge of security‑by‑design principles, resilience, disaster recovery, and business continuity in automated environments.
- Excellent troubleshooting and root cause analysis skills across complex automated systems.
